Introduction To Locula 30% Eye Drop

Locula 30% Eye Drop is an antibiotic used to treat bacterial infections of the eye. It fights the infection by stopping the growth of bacteria. This helps to cure the underlying infection.

Locula 30% Eye Drop should be used as directed by your doctor. It should be used regularly at evenly spaced time intervals as prescribed by your doctor. Do not skip any doses and finish the full course of treatment even if you feel better. Stopping the medicine too early may lead to the infection returning or worsening.

It is effective in killing many types of bacteria. However, it will not work for other types of eye infections (e.g., viral) and therefore, should only be used if prescribed by your doctor. Unnecessary use of any antibiotic can lead to a decrease in its effectiveness in the future.

Commonly seen side effects seen with this medicine include temporary eye irritation and stinging in the eyes after administration. Consult your doctor if these side effects persist or if your condition worsens. Seek emergency medical help if you get a rash, itchy skin, swelling of face and mouth, or have difficulty breathing. Contact lenses should not be worn while you are using this medicine or while you have a bacterial eye infection.

How to use Locula 30% Eye Drop

This medicine is for external use only. Use it in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. Check the label for directions before use. Hold the dropper close to the eye without touching it. Gently squeeze the dropper and place the medicine inside the lower eyelid. Wipe off the extra liquid.

Safety Advice

sdsP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Can I take Locula 30% Eye Drop if I’m pregnant?

Locula 30% Eye Drop may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Please consult your doctor.

sdsBreastfeed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Can I take Locula 30% Eye Drop if I’m breastfeeding?

Information regarding the use of Locula 30% Eye Drop during breastfeeding is not available. Please consult your doctor.

sdsDriving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Can I drive after taking Locula 30% Eye Drop?

It is not known whether Locula 30% Eye Drop alters the ability to drive. Do not drive if you experience any symptoms that affect your ability to concentrate and react.
